Providing scalable on-demand interactive video service by means of multicasting and client buffering

True-VOD provides interactive on-demand (i.e., virtually zero start-up delay) video service by allocating each user a dedicated stream. Such streaming technique, however, cannot scale up to accommodate a large number of users. A more scalable solution is to use multicasting and client buffering. In this paper, we propose a client-initiated (client-pull) on-demand scheme in which short unicast streams are used to “merge” users onto the existing multicast streams by means of pre-buffering. The scheme is observed to trade off some bandwidth with lower buffer requirement as compared with a previously proposed scheme. We then propose and analyze a server-initiated (server-push) scheme for on-demand interactive applications. The scheme is shown to offer service level similar to true-VOD with substantially (many times) lower bandwidth, even with high user interactivity (e.g., averaged ten VCR commands/viewing).
